Materials and care

Material

Stainless steel

Care

Dishwasher-safe.

For the cutlery to be easy to clean and to reduce the risk of corrosion, always rinse off the remains of any food immediately.

Wash, rinse and dry your cutlery before using it for the first time.

What is stainless steel?

Stainless steel is found in everything from building structures and cars to sinks and knives. It’s easy to see why it has so many uses. Stainless steel is hard and durable and has good resistance to corrosion – namely rust. It generally has a low nickel content, and for IKEA products we mainly use stainless steel that’s nickel-free. Like many other metals, it can be recycled again and again to become new, hardwearing things – without losing its valuable properties.
